Testing is a crucial pillar in the development process. It goes beyond simply validating that software functions as expected. True testing involves rigorously uncovering hidden flaws and enhancing the overall quality of a product. By pinpointing these issues early on, developers can address them before they impact users, consequently leading to a smoother and more enjoyable experience.

Methods for Test Automation: Streamlining the Testing Process

Efficient system testing relies heavily on automation. By utilizing effective test automation strategies, development teams can significantly improve the speed, accuracy, and coverage of their testing efforts. These strategies often involve leveraging specialized tools to execute repetitive tasks, freeing testers to focus on more complex aspects of the testing process. Key elements of successful test automation encompass clear test cases, robust infrastructure selection, and continuous monitoring to ensure optimal efficiency.
